终于放假了,在家也是无事,上学期在学校接了一个TI的项目,既然是TI公司的项目那就没办法,主控制器只能用TI自己的单片机,所以这个寒假就打算用业余时间学一下MSP430单片机---号称目前为止最低功耗的单片机。其实我也是刚刚开始接触430,虽然以前也有过51,32等单片机的学习经历,但还是打算仔细研究一下430这款单片机,也是和大家一起共同学习吧,那就从头来,今天就给大家来分享一下新建一个430工程的问题,毕竟干什么事得先有个家,而学习单片机的这个家就是一个工程
下载安装430单片机的编译软件CCS,CCS是TI公司的一款收费软件,但是对于学生开发工程,它是有免费版的,大家去TI官网搜索下载就可以了,在这里我废话不多说。
打开软件,跟着我按照图来吧(我用的是这款板子,G2553)
:
这个对话框你的配置你按照我的箭头指示的来就行(如果你用的是其他型号的单片机在型号里面改一下就OK了)
然后拷贝这段代码到你的main.c文件里面,改一改引脚,下载到你的板子上看看你的LED能不能闪烁起来
#include"MSP430G2553.h"
void Blink_LED()
{
_delay_cycles(1000000);
P1OUT^=BIT6; //LED亮灭改变
}
void main()
{
WDTCTL = WDTPW + WDTHOLD;//关狗
P1DIR = BIT6;
while(1)
{
Blink_LED();//调用子函数
}
}
如果闪烁起来,那么恭喜你,你已经入门430单片机了!